SuSE 10.0 und Bluetooth USB Adapter BELKIN F8T013 (und Handy Motorola RAZR V3x)
Hallo, Hat jemand diesen funktionierend im Einsatz. Habe mit yast2 Bluetooth konfiguriert und fast alle Dienste freigegeben ausser die Human Dienste für Maus und Tastatur etc. Die abfrage nach Bluetooth-Geräten habe ich auf 3 min gestellt. Die Module werden auch alle geladen und der Adapter sucht auch nach Bluetooth-Geräten. Wenn ich nun am Handy Bluetooth einschalte und suchen lasse, findet der Rechner das Handy mit dem angegeben Namen und das Handy den Rechnernamen. Es funktioniert aber kein einziger Bluetooth-Dienst. Habe es auch schon mit und ohne Pin probiert. Wenn natürlich kein Dienst funktioniert, kommt es auch nicht zur Pin abfrage am Handy. Kann mir da jemand weiter helfen. Viele Grüße, Heinz Dittmar
Hallo. * Dienstag, 14. Februar 2006 um 13:38 (+0100) schrieb Heinz Dittmar:
Hat jemand diesen funktionierend im Einsatz.
Ich habe zwar keinen Belkin BT-Adapter, aber...
Wenn ich nun am Handy Bluetooth einschalte und suchen lasse, findet der Rechner das Handy mit dem angegeben Namen und das Handy den Rechnernamen. Es funktioniert aber kein einziger Bluetooth-Dienst. Habe es auch schon mit und ohne Pin probiert. Wenn natürlich kein Dienst funktioniert, kommt es auch nicht zur Pin abfrage am Handy.
... was gibt denn 'rcbluetooth status' aus und was erscheint im Konqueror nach Eingabe von "sdp://localhost"? Gruß Andreas -- XMMS spielt gerade nichts... PGP-ID/Fingerprint: BD7C2E59/3E 11 E5 29 0C A8 2F 49 40 6C 2D 5F 12 9D E1 E3 PGP-Key on request or on public keyservers --
Am Dienstag Februar 14 2006 14:42 schrieb Andreas Koenecke:
Hallo.
* Dienstag, 14. Februar 2006 um 13:38 (+0100) schrieb Heinz Dittmar:
Hat jemand diesen funktionierend im Einsatz.
Ich habe zwar keinen Belkin BT-Adapter, aber...
Wenn ich nun am Handy Bluetooth einschalte und suchen lasse, findet der Rechner das Handy mit dem angegeben Namen und das Handy den Rechnernamen. Es funktioniert aber kein einziger Bluetooth-Dienst. Habe es auch schon mit und ohne Pin probiert. Wenn natürlich kein Dienst funktioniert, kommt es auch nicht zur Pin abfrage am Handy.
... was gibt denn 'rcbluetooth status' aus und was erscheint im Konqueror heinz@hedi-1:~> rcbluetooth status Checking service bluetooth (enabled) : hcid (activated) running hidd unused hid2hci unused sdpd (activated) running opd (activated) running rfcomm (activated) pand (activated) running dund (activated) running heinz@hedi-1:~> nach Eingabe von "sdp://localhost"? OBEX Object Push Obex Push Server KBtSerialChat KDE Bemused Server LAN Access Point Network Access Point
Viele Grüße, Heinz Dittmar
Hallo. * Dienstag, 14. Februar 2006 um 15:50 (+0100) schrieb Heinz Dittmar:
Am Dienstag Februar 14 2006 14:42 schrieb Andreas Koenecke:
... was gibt denn 'rcbluetooth status' aus und was erscheint im Konqueror
heinz@hedi-1:~> rcbluetooth status Checking service bluetooth (enabled) : hcid (activated) running hidd unused hid2hci unused sdpd (activated) running opd (activated) running rfcomm (activated) pand (activated) running dund (activated) running heinz@hedi-1:~>
nach Eingabe von "sdp://localhost"? OBEX Object Push Obex Push Server KBtSerialChat KDE Bemused Server LAN Access Point Network Access Point
Das sieht doch sehr gut aus aus. Wird das Handy im Konqueror nach der Eingabe von "bluetooth:/" angezeigt? (Falls nicht: Konqueror mit "bluetooth:/"-Zeile geöffnet lassen, "Find me" am Handy wählen, "Neu laden" im Konqueror drücken.) Welche Dienste willst du denn nutzen? Gruß Andreas -- XMMS spielt gerade "The Who - You Better You Bet"... PGP-ID/Fingerprint: BD7C2E59/3E 11 E5 29 0C A8 2F 49 40 6C 2D 5F 12 9D E1 E3 PGP-Key on request or on public keyservers --
Am Dienstag Februar 14 2006 16:55 schrieb Andreas Koenecke:
Hallo.
* Dienstag, 14. Februar 2006 um 15:50 (+0100) schrieb Heinz Dittmar:
Am Dienstag Februar 14 2006 14:42 schrieb Andreas Koenecke:
... was gibt denn 'rcbluetooth status' aus und was erscheint im Konqueror
heinz@hedi-1:~> rcbluetooth status Checking service bluetooth (enabled) : hcid (activated) running hidd unused hid2hci unused sdpd (activated) running opd (activated) running rfcomm (activated) pand (activated) running dund (activated) running heinz@hedi-1:~>
nach Eingabe von "sdp://localhost"?
OBEX Object Push Obex Push Server KBtSerialChat KDE Bemused Server LAN Access Point Network Access Point
Das sieht doch sehr gut aus aus.
Wird das Handy im Konqueror nach der Eingabe von "bluetooth:/" angezeigt? Ja es wird angezeigt mit dem richtigen Bluetooth Namen vom Handy. (Falls nicht: Konqueror mit "bluetooth:/"-Zeile geöffnet lassen, "Find me" am Handy wählen, "Neu laden" im Konqueror drücken.)
Welche Dienste willst du denn nutzen? Das Handy findet keinen Dienst. Somit kann keine Applikation funktionieren. Viele Grüße, Heinz Dittmar
Hallo. * Dienstag, 14. Februar 2006 um 21:12 (+0100) schrieb Heinz Dittmar:
Am Dienstag Februar 14 2006 16:55 schrieb Andreas Koenecke:
Welche Dienste willst du denn nutzen?
Das Handy findet keinen Dienst. Somit kann keine Applikation funktionieren.
Den Satz verstehe ich nicht. Hat denn dein Motorola einen BT-Service-Browser? Mein V3 hat AFAIK keinen. Kannst du per OBEX Dateien vom und zum Handy transferieren? Sag' doch mal konkret, was du machen willst. Gruß Andreas -- XMMS spielt gerade "The Who - The Seeker"... PGP-ID/Fingerprint: BD7C2E59/3E 11 E5 29 0C A8 2F 49 40 6C 2D 5F 12 9D E1 E3 PGP-Key on request or on public keyservers --
Am Dienstag Februar 14 2006 22:17 schrieb Andreas Koenecke:
Hallo.
* Dienstag, 14. Februar 2006 um 21:12 (+0100) schrieb Heinz Dittmar:
Am Dienstag Februar 14 2006 16:55 schrieb Andreas Koenecke:
Welche Dienste willst du denn nutzen?
Das Handy findet keinen Dienst. Somit kann keine Applikation funktionieren.
Den Satz verstehe ich nicht. Hat denn dein Motorola einen BT-Service-Browser? Mein V3 hat AFAIK keinen. Kannst du per OBEX Dateien vom und zum Handy transferieren? Sag' doch mal konkret, was du machen willst. Ja so was ähnliches muß doch das Handy haben. Ich kann ja den Diensten eine Pin-Nummer geben, dann muß doch das Handy nach der Pin-Nummer Fragen um eine Verbindung herzustellen, oder sehe ich da was falsch. ?
Viele Grüße, Heinz Dittmar
Hallo. * Mittwoch, 15. Februar 2006 um 04:24 (+0100) schrieb Heinz Dittmar:
Am Dienstag Februar 14 2006 22:17 schrieb Andreas Koenecke:
* Dienstag, 14. Februar 2006 um 21:12 (+0100) schrieb Heinz Dittmar:
Das Handy findet keinen Dienst. Somit kann keine Applikation funktionieren.
Den Satz verstehe ich nicht. Hat denn dein Motorola einen BT-Service-Browser? Mein V3 hat AFAIK keinen. Kannst du per OBEX Dateien vom und zum Handy transferieren? Sag' doch mal konkret, was du machen willst.
Ja so was ähnliches muß doch das Handy haben. Ich kann ja den Diensten eine Pin-Nummer geben, dann muß doch das Handy nach der Pin-Nummer Fragen um eine Verbindung herzustellen, oder sehe ich da was falsch. ?
Nicht jeder Dienst erfordert AFAIK ein Pairing, OBEX z.B. funktioniert hier auch ohne. Wenn du ein Pairing durchführen willst, dann greife auf das Handy über "/dev/rfcomm0" zu (Darüber kannst/musst du auch mit den 'kmobiletools' auf das Handy zugreifen.): 1. Ermittle mit 'hcitool scan' die BT-Adresse deines Handys (während der "Find me"-Phase) 2. In einem root-Terminal: 'rfcomm bind 0 <BT-Adresse> 1'. 3. Weiterhin im root-Terminal: 'echo AT > /dev/rfcomm0'. Jetzt sollten Handy und Rechner nach der PIN fragen. Eingeben -- Pairing abgeschlossen! Wenn das funktioniert hat, dann solltest du "/etc/bluetooth/rfcomm.conf" konfigurieren, das spart zukünftig Schritt 2. Und Entfernen des Kommentarzeichens in Zeile 6 von "/etc/udev/rules.d/40-bluetooth.rules" setzt dann in Zukunft die Zugriffsrechte auf "/dev/rfcomm0" usertauglich... (SUSE 10.0) Gruß Andreas -- XMMS spielt gerade "The Who - Baba O'Riley"... PGP-ID/Fingerprint: BD7C2E59/3E 11 E5 29 0C A8 2F 49 40 6C 2D 5F 12 9D E1 E3 PGP-Key on request or on public keyservers --
Am Mittwoch Februar 15 2006 12:40 schrieb Andreas Koenecke:
Hallo.
* Mittwoch, 15. Februar 2006 um 04:24 (+0100) schrieb Heinz Dittmar:
Am Dienstag Februar 14 2006 22:17 schrieb Andreas Koenecke:
* Dienstag, 14. Februar 2006 um 21:12 (+0100) schrieb Heinz Dittmar:
Das Handy findet keinen Dienst. Somit kann keine Applikation funktionieren.
Den Satz verstehe ich nicht. Hat denn dein Motorola einen BT-Service-Browser? Mein V3 hat AFAIK keinen. Kannst du per OBEX Dateien vom und zum Handy transferieren? Sag' doch mal konkret, was du machen willst.
Ja so was ähnliches muß doch das Handy haben. Ich kann ja den Diensten eine Pin-Nummer geben, dann muß doch das Handy nach der Pin-Nummer Fragen um eine Verbindung herzustellen, oder sehe ich da was falsch. ?
Nicht jeder Dienst erfordert AFAIK ein Pairing, OBEX z.B. funktioniert hier auch ohne. Wenn du ein Pairing durchführen willst, dann greife auf das Handy über "/dev/rfcomm0" zu (Darüber kannst/musst du auch mit den 'kmobiletools' auf das Handy zugreifen.): Das Hauptproblem war das Handy, nach Global Zurücksetzen am Handy:
1. Ermittle mit 'hcitool scan' die BT-Adresse deines Handys (während der "Find me"-Phase) OK
2. In einem root-Terminal: 'rfcomm bind 0 <BT-Adresse> 1'. OK
3. Weiterhin im root-Terminal: 'echo AT > /dev/rfcomm0'. Jetzt sollten Handy und Rechner nach der PIN fragen. Eingeben -- Pairing abgeschlossen! OK
Wenn das funktioniert hat, dann solltest du "/etc/bluetooth/rfcomm.conf" konfigurieren, das spart zukünftig Schritt 2. Und Entfernen des Kommentarzeichens in Zeile 6 von "/etc/udev/rules.d/40-bluetooth.rules" setzt dann in Zukunft die Zugriffsrechte auf "/dev/rfcomm0" usertauglich... (SUSE 10.0) Das waren wichtige Informatioen die ich vorher nirgends nachlesen konnte, habe ich getan und funktioniert. Vielen Dank dafür. Das Handy ist bei mir das Problem, spätestens nach dem dritten Versuch, funktioniert das Verbinden nicht mehr, ich muss dann den Eintrag löschen und Global Zurücksetzen, daß es wieder funktioniert. Die Firmware auf dem Handy ist totaler Schrott und muß upgedatet werden. Mein nächster Versuch machte ich mit kmobiletools, weil zumindest die Feldstärke und Ladeanzeige mit diesem Handy mit USB funktionierte. Da kommt die nächste Überraschung: 1.) Feldstärke und Ladeanzeige funktionieren nicht. 2.) Das Telefonbuch kann ich lesen, was bei USB nicht funktionierte. Das ist sehr sonderbar dabei ändert sich ja nur die Gerätedatei von /dev/ttyACM0 auf /dev/rfcomm0 . Beides benutzt ja vom Programm her die selben seriellen AT-Kommandos. Ich muß jetzt zuerst das Handy beim Motorola Kundendienst die Firmware neu Aufspielen oder upgraden lassen, da sie öffentlich nicht zur Verfügung steht. Ich werde dann weiter berichten was funktioniert und was nicht. Viele Grüße, Heinz Dittmar
participants (2)
-
Andreas Koenecke
-
Heinz Dittmar